Description

⭐ ⭐ ⭐ ⭐ This non-mendelian genetics and inheritance webquest teaches your students about codominance, incomplete dominance, Punnett squares, and polygenic traits. This genetics webquest includes an engaging Amoeba Sisters video, a heredity virtual lab, and incomplete dominance and codominance Punnett squares practice. Your download includes an editable version, PDF version, and Google Slides version.

NGSSHS-LS3-3
Apply concepts of statistics and probability to explain the variation and distribution of expressed traits in a population. Emphasis is on the use of mathematics to describe the probability of traits as it relates to genetic and environmental factors in the expression of traits. Assessment does not include Hardy-Weinberg calculations.
NGSSHS-LS3-1
Ask questions to clarify relationships about the role of DNA and chromosomes in coding the instructions for characteristic traits passed from parents to offspring. Assessment does not include the phases of meiosis or the biochemical mechanism of specific steps in the process.
